Conversion Formula for Cal It Second to Erg Second
Conversion from cal it second to erg second is a simple process once you know the basic relationship between the two units. One Cal It Second is equal to 41,840,000 Erg Second, while one Erg Second contains 0.0000000239 Cal It Second.
To change a measurement from cal it second to erg second, you only need to multiply the number of cal it second by 41,840,000.
1 Cal It Second = 41,840,000 Erg Second
1 Erg Second = 0.0000000239 Cal It Second

Erg per Second (CGS Power Unit)
Introduction : The erg per second is a CGS (centimeter-gram-second) unit of power. It defines the rate of doing work at one erg per second, equal to 1e-7 watts. Suitable for small-scale scientific and atomic-level measurements.
History & Origin : Introduced in the 19th century with the CGS system, the erg per second was widely used in classical physics, especially in electromagnetism and thermodynamics. It was eventually superseded by watt-based SI units.
Current Use : Primarily used in physics and astronomy to describe extremely small or precise power outputs, like light from a faint star or heat at microscopic scales. Still seen in theoretical or legacy scientific texts.
